Moscow will introduce a "yellow" weather hazard level due to icy conditions. This was announced on Sunday, March 16, according to the website of the Hydrometeorological Center.

The warning will be valid from 21:00 on Sunday, March 16, to 09:00 on Thursday, March 20.

A similar level of danger will be in effect in the Moscow region, the website notes. kp.ru .

Residents of some other regions of central Russia were also warned about the ice, in particular, the Belgorod, Bryansk, Vladimir, Kaluga, Kursk, Ryazan, Tver and Tula regions.

Earlier in the day, meteorologist, leading specialist of the Phobos weather Center Evgeny Tishkovets reported that on the night of March 16, the capital recorded the most severe frosts since the beginning of spring. In the Moscow region, the thermometer dropped to -15 degrees, writes IA Regnum.

At the same time, Tishkovets said that the spring weather would return to Moscow on Friday, March 21. During the day, the air temperature will rise to +4...+9 degrees. Over the weekend, there will be a significant increase in atmospheric pressure — up to 762 mmHg, which will exceed the norm by 15 units, notes 360.ru .

On March 15, Tishkovets, in an interview with Izvestia, noted that at the beginning of next week, starting on Monday, March 17, winter in the capital will remind itself again. The temperature at night will be -1...-3, during the daytime — about 0.

The day before, the heat record was updated in the capital. The air temperature at the VDNKh base station was +11.8 degrees at 08:00. This is 0.4 degrees higher than the previous record for this day, set in 2001, writes NSN.
